cincinnati-style chili

Do you love Gold Star or Skyline Chili from Cincinnati? We do! This recipe is as close as you can get without being there! And, your choice to make it either a 3, 4 or 5-way...but always add the Oyster crackers!

Ingredients For cincinnati-style chili

  • 2 1/2 lb
    ground beef
  • 2 lg
    onions, chopped
  • 3 can
    8-oz each, tomato sauce
  • 1 c
    water
  • 1/2 oz
    unsweetened chocolate, cut up
  • 2 Tbsp
    chili powder
  • 2 Tbsp
    apple cider vinegar
  • 2 tsp
    worcestershire sauce
  • 1 1/2 tsp
    cinnamon
  • 1 tsp
    ground cumin
  • 1/2 tsp
    salt
  • 1/4 tsp
    garlic powder
  • 1/4 tsp
    ground allspice
  • 1/8 tsp
    ground cloves
  • 1
    bay leaf
  • 1
    dried red chili pepper or
  • 1/4 tsp
    ground red pepper
  • hot cooked spaghetti noodles
  • GARNISH
  • chopped onions
  • sh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1 can
    15-oz kidney beans, drained and warmed
  • oyster crackers
  • hot sauce

How To Make cincinnati-style chili

  • 1
    In a 4 1/2 quart Dutch oven or heavy saucepan, cook ground beef with the 2 onions until beef is no longer pink; drain off any fat.
  • 2
    Add the tomato sauce, water, chocolate, chili powder, vinegar, worchestershire sauce, cinnamon, cumin, salt, garlic powder, allspice, clove, bay leaf, and red chili pepper or ground red pepper.
  • 3
    Bring to boiling; reduce heat. Simmer, covered, over low heat for 45 minutes or until desired consistency; stirring once or twice.
  • 4
    Remove bay leaf and, if using, chili pepper. Serve over hot cooked spaghetti and, if desired, top with onions, cheese and/or beans. Offer Oyster crackers and hot sauce!
